Improving the lives of children and families through integrated services

Ofsted good practice example showing how East Hastings Children’s Centre uses integrated services to improve the lives of children and families.

Details

This example shows how East Hastings Children’s Centre uses well-integrated services from a wide range of professional agencies and an extensive network of volunteers to improve the lives of local children and families.
